Full job description
The University of Oxford’s Saïd Business School is seeking an outstanding academic leader to serve as its next Dean, leading a globally recognised business school distinguished by its international outlook, entrepreneurial spirit, academic excellence, and commitment to addressing complex global challenges through research, education, and engagement.
The Dean will provide strategic and academic leadership across all aspects of the School’s activities, working collaboratively with colleagues across the collegiate University and beyond. Alongside advancing research excellence, educational innovation, and external engagement, the Dean will play a central role in fostering an inclusive, supportive, and high-performing culture. The successful candidate will demonstrate a deeply people-centred approach to leadership, with the ability to build trust, empower others, develop talent, and create an environment in which faculty, professional services staff, and students can thrive. They will be effective in building trusted relationships internally and externally, and in bringing people together around a shared sense of purpose and ambition. They will bring intellectual credibility, strategic judgement, and outstanding leadership skills, together with the ability to inspire and unite a diverse community. They will be an effective ambassador for the School, building strong relationships within the School, across Oxford, and with alumni, donors, policymakers, industry leaders, and partners across the globe.
This is a rare opportunity to lead one of the world’s most distinctive business schools at a time of profound change, and to shape the contribution Oxford Saïd can make to business, policy, and society in the years ahead.
